HUARD’S
24TH ANNUAL BATTLE OF MAINE MARTIAL ARTS CHAMPIONSHIPS
By Mark Schmetzer
The 24th
Annual Battle of Maine Martial Arts Championships took place on
Saturday, March 20, 2004 at the Sukee Arena in Winslow, Maine.
The event was promoted by Randy, Mike and Mark Huard and the
Huard’s Martial Arts School. The Battle of Maine is one of the largest and most
prestigious sport karate events held in New England.
The event was rated by IPPONE and rated A by Maine S.M.AR.T.
It featured over 154 divisions and received statewide cable
television and newspaper coverage. Part of the proceeds will benefit the
Children’s Miracle Network. Over
1,100 spectators and 640 competitors attended this outstanding event.
Prior to the event on
Thursday Master Young Won and members of K.I.C.K. Team (Jonathan Boyd,
Ryan Redfoot, Nick Schilling, Andrew Schmetzer, Kristopher Schmetzer,
and Jake Strickland) conducted seminars on what is required to become a
World Class competitor. The
first session for Tiny Tigers and Dragons included instruction on the
importance of stretching, proper stances, blocks, and punches. They later learned a few basic combinations.
In the second session the older athletes were given the same
instructions plus more advanced techniques.
It was a very exciting night of martial arts instruction and
exhibition for all!
On Friday Lauren
Kearney and members of K.I.C.K. Team provided private lessons for the
athletes wanting individual instructions.

The main event was
Saturday when the action continued at the Battle of Maine.
It attracted many of the world’s best competitors from K.I.C.K.
Team, Team JPhillips Creative Management, Team Paul Mitchell, Team
Sansei, Studio Unis, Team Sidekick, and Team Straight Up.
They came from all over U.S.A and Canada.
The event started with spectacular individual demonstrations from
the special guests. These special guests included Robbie Andreozzi,
Jalil Atlaschi, Richie Bichara, Jonathan Boyd, Chrissy Concepcion,
Jennifer Espina, Justin Eaton, Tegan Isartel, Lauren Kearney, Joshua
Quartin, Ryan Redfoot, Becca Ross, Nick Schilling, Elizabeth Sipes,
Andrew Schmetzer, Kristopher Schmetzer, Jake Strickland, and Al
Szafranski. It really
energized the crowd. The
demonstration concluded with a group performance that included Andreozzi,
Atlaschi, Boyd, Concepcion, Eaton, Kearney, Redfoot, Schilling, A.
Schmetzer, K. Schmetzer, and Strickland.
There was also some
outstanding New England Sport Karate Teams that attended the battle,
such as Jukado All Stars, Pushard’s Sport Karate Team, Team Tao, HSK
Team, Team Excel and many others.
The tournament
started with the Youth Divisions and proceeded through the Adult
Divisions, including the heart warming Handicapable Divisions.

After the
eliminations concluded, the division winners competed for the Grand
Championships. Winners
included:
Grand
Champion Winners
Men
& Women Forms Grand Champion – Allan Viernes
Senior
Men Point Fighting – Wayne Mellos
Women’s
Point Fighting – Felicia Whitten
Men
and Woman Weapons – Andy Da'mato
Chanbara
Grand Champion – Shane Gallagher
Men’s
Fighting – Robbie Lavoie
Youth
Black Belt Overall – Cory Lutkus
Adult
Under Belt Overall – Clint Childs
